			Certain alpha run lengths (for SHQ1/SHQ3/SHQ5) could be stored in both long and short versions, and we would only accept the short version, returning -1 (invalid code) for the others. This could cause an out-of-bounds write on malicious input, as discovered by Andreas Cadhalpun during fuzzing. Fix by simply allowing both versions, leaving no invalid codes in the alpha VLC.
